Answer: P(x < 0.285) = 0.0668
Step-by-step explanation:
Since the diameters of pencils produced by the machine are normally distributed, we would apply the formula for normal distribution which is expressed as
z = (x - µ)/σ
Where
x = diameters of pencils produced .
µ = mean diameter
σ = standard deviation
From the information given,
µ = 0.30 inches
σ = 0.01 inches
The probability that the diameter of a randomly selected pencil will be less than 0.285 inches is expressed as
P(x < 0.285)
For x = 0.285
z = (0.285 - 0.30)/0.01 = - 1.5
Looking at the normal distribution table, the probability corresponding to the z score is 0.0668
